### Capacity note: Brimtable 4.2 planner regression

Since the 4.2 upgrade, the planner prefers nested-loop joins on mid-cardinality tables, inflating CPU on the reporting replicas by roughly a third at peak. We can hold the release if we pin the cost model overrides rather than reverting, which keeps the new index advisor. The overrides we validated in staging are the constants below.

tuning table, kajog-bawip:
TIERS = {
    "kelius": 256,
    "lammir": 543,
}

## Further Reading

If you're cutting a release that touches the Fennick markdown pipeline, skim the architecture notes first — the renderer, sanitizer, and cache layers version independently, and mismatches cause subtle escaping bugs. There's also a short checklist for verifying output parity before shipping. All of it, plus past release gotchas, is collected on this page.

wiki page, tagef-bajog: https://grafana.nelvrocorp.corp/projects/pages/display/fa238a928afe

Finance Review Summary — Corven Hospitality Group

For the incoming director: the franchise agreement with Almsworth Kitchens was reviewed this quarter. Royalty terms remain at 6% of gross receipts, with the marketing levy capped through year three. Two underperforming sites in Dunbray triggered the remediation clause; Almsworth has until Q2 to present a turnaround plan. Cash flow impact is modest but the renewal window opens in fourteen months. Strategic direction for that negotiation is outlined in the confidential note below.

board note of fahif-yahog: Gross margin on Wenath came in at 10 percent against a plan of 5 percent. Only 3 of the 100 pilot accounts renewed Wenath, so a churn review is set for July 15.

## Ledgervane Environments — Timezone Handling in Report Exports

Ledgervane exports always normalize timestamps to UTC at ingestion, then apply the requesting tenant's display zone at render time. Staging intentionally uses a fixed fictional zone to surface offset bugs early. As a new contractor, please never hardcode offsets. The staging export service reads the following values at startup.

deployment values, fahap-hahaf:
[casdor]
port = 9200
region = south-2
host = casdor.qirvanworks.corp
timeout_ms = 3000
retries = 4